## Account Recovery — Sheetloader CSV Import Wizard

Hey, new folks: this comes up more than you'd think. When the Sheetloader service account gets locked (usually after the import wizard hammers the auth endpoint during a big batch), customers see "mapping step unavailable" errors. Don't panic. First check the Granview status board to rule out a wider outage. Then open the admin shell, run the unlock flow for the wizard's service account, and pick "recover with passphrase." When the prompt appears, enter the phrase listed just below.

unlock words, hahip-baduf: holwyn-istath-julvan

MEMO — Records Team, Hollan Safeworks. Replacement lock for safe unit in the Drexley annex ships today via Pinrow Express. Serial logged, carton sealed, no copies of the combination enclosed. File this memo with the asset record. Courier collection at 11:00. The hand-over must follow the single instruction below.

dispatch memo: the quenvan holax courier leaves the zoreth briath kasvan ledger at gate 7481 under passcode 618862

Welcome aboard! Visitors at Marrowvale Point can't just wander through the shuttle-bus gate — they need to be signed in at the kiosk first, then walked through by you. The gate marshal checks everyone, so don't skip the register. To open the pedestrian gate for your escorted guest, punch in the code below.

turnstile pass: bdg-M-14

**Q: I'm a contractor — how do I get edit rights on the Lanternwick wiki?**

A: Contractors start as Readers. Editor role requires approval from your sponsor. Submit the role request form; approval takes one business day. If you're locked out after role changes, the access console accepts the contractor recovery passphrase to restore your session. Use the passphrase shown below.

unlock words, bagag-kajef: zormir-jorath-tammir-oliius-briix-norys

## Formula sandbox tuning

User-supplied formulas in Gridmoor execute inside a restricted interpreter with hard ceilings on time, memory, and call depth. Reviewers should confirm any change to these ceilings is justified in the PR description, since raising them widens the abuse surface. Defaults were chosen from production traces. The current limits are as follows.

limits module of tafog-fawip:
WEIGHTS = {
    "julix": 57,
    "lamys": 992,
    "kasvan": 209,
    "quenok": 750,
    "alddor": 259,
    "oliath": 1009,
    "wenix": 815,
}